Austin: Great advice! If you're going to mail anything to the DMV (or IRS), make a copy (front and back) of everything you send before you send it. If you want to be super cautious, take your letter to the post office and get a return receipt and/or registration for the letter. It will cost an extra buck or two to send it, but you will get a postcard in the mail that is signed by the DMV which says that they received it.
